NSI Technical Trainer
North Star Imaging (NSI), a global leader in 2D digital radiography and 3D computed
tomography equipment, is part of Illinois Tool Works (ITW), a Fortune 250 company. We offer
an engaging work environment with exceptional opportunities for personal and career
development.
NSI Technical Trainers provide onsite and remote support for NSI equipment, specializing in
industrial computed tomography and radiography systems. Their responsibilities include
delivering training on software applications, system operation, operator usage,
troubleshooting, and basic repairs to ensure optimal performance and user proficiency.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ide software support and assistance to NSI customers via onsite or remote as
required for imaging or troubleshooting. - Provide operator training on x-ray imaging systems including software applications,
general operational theory and basic maintenance. - Provide component system installation or installation assistance.
- Provide technical assistance or support for installed base of equipment via phone,
onsite and remote access.Perform warranty, paid service and service contract activities.
60% of the position involves training end users on our software packages. - Classroom sizes are up to 10 people who have a variety technical expertise and ability.
- Assist in completing technical manuals and writing system operation manuals or work
instructions. - Creating training videos for internal or external use.
- Provide customers with timely updates as to the progress of their service and support
requests. - Assist manufacturing with system integration and factory acceptance tests.
- Work with application engineers on developing scanning techniques using proprietary
imaging software for customer-specific applications - Work with the service coordinator on scheduling and billing.
